Specifications

Attribute Value
Package Bulk
ProductStatus Active
OutputConfiguration Positive
OutputType Adjustable
NumberofRegulators 1
Voltage-Input(Max) 26V
Voltage-Output(Min/Fixed) 5V
Voltage-Output(Max) 20V
VoltageDropout(Max) 1V @ 1A
Current-Output 1A
Current-Quiescent(Iq) 10 mA
Current-Supply(Max) 15 mA
ControlFeatures Enable
ProtectionFeatures Over Temperature, Reverse Polarity, Short Circuit
OperatingTemperature -40°C ~ 125°C
MountingType Surface Mount
Package/Case 8-WDFN Exposed Pad

Overview

Description

The LM2941LD is a low-dropout (LDO) linear voltage regulator designed for applications requiring a constant output voltage with low input-to-output voltage differential. It features an adjustable output voltage with a range typically from 5V to 20V, depending on the specific application and external components used. The device is known for its high efficiency and low quiescent current, which make it suitable for battery-powered devices. It offers protections such as current limiting and thermal shutdown to safeguard against over-current and overheating conditions. The LM2941LD is often used in automotive, industrial, and consumer electronics where stable voltage supply is crucial.
Key specifications include a maximum output current of 1A and a dropout voltage typically around 0.5V at full load, which allows it to maintain regulation with minimal power loss. Its compact design and reliable performance make it a popular choice for designs requiring efficient power management. The device is available in various package types, providing flexibility for different layouts and thermal management requirements.
